Transaction 1d29077825ed1ab9f82539ea5781ac61786356413e1cf3bf535b5aa2eb91ced5
1 Input
1 Output
-
1d29077825ed1ab9f82539ea5781ac61786356413e1cf3bf535b5aa2eb91ced5:0
- value
- 1474724509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74e9cd6b8ea428317a0916de3d1a192fd4799e25 OP_EQUAL
- address
- 3CMCPfzrFTVRT5HpchdHs2uLpABNHjVWby